    You won't like this advice...

    You're just starting, so my advice is to let the cold run it's course and when you are healthy to start the diet. When you switch over from a carb-burning metabolism to a fat burning one, you're body will under go numerous changes. I don't think you need this added physicial and mental stress on top of a cold.

                    cold

                    I went out and spent $400 on atkins friendly food and 3 days into it I had a bad sore throat and it kept egtting worse. I didn't want to "waste" the ketosis that I finally got in, so i bought some throat medicine (robutussine) and after just one serving I was out of ketosis.

                    I then discovered robutussin makes some type of carb free cough syrup for diabetics and i got that and it worked.

                    You can also buy carb free chicken broth and warm up a few cans of that and drink it.

                    No need to wait to start atkins.
